Application
Braycote 640AC is designed as an oxidizer and propellant compatible lubricant suitable for use in the aerospace industry
vehicles, spacecraft, rocket and aircraft engines and related ground support equipment, oxygen equipment,
and transportation equipment. Braycote 640AC is typically used for lubrication of threaded fasteners, connectors,
valves, seals, elastomers and bearings. Perfluorinated greases, in general, exhibit excellent shelf life
their inner inertness.

Temperature Range
-36ºC to 204ºC (- 30ºf to 400ºF) under Normal operating conditions and up to 260ºC (500ºF) for short periods.
Limitations
Braycote 640AC is compatible with all commonly used metals, plastics and elastomers. Braycote can be 640AC
it is negatively affected by Lewis acids such as aluminum chloride at high temperatures. New exposed friction
surfaces of aluminum, magnesium or titanium alloys can react with BRAYCOTE 640AC under certain conditions.
Such systems should be thoroughly evaluated. Surfaces should be well cleaned from organic rust inhibitors before starting.
grease application to ensure proper lubrication. This product is not recommended for use in the following applications
high vacuum with loads exceeding 100,000 psi for long time.
